How much do software engineer engineer j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for software engineer engineer in Joliet, IL is $142,780.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$116,100.00 and $167,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ges software engineers face when collaborating on large projects?

Software engineers working on large projects often encounter challenges related to coordinating effectively with cross-functional teams, managing code integration, and maintaining clear communication. It's common to deal with merge conflicts, overlapping responsibilities, and aligning on technical standards and project timelines. To overcome these challenges, engineers typically use version control systems, participate in regular stand-up meetings, and follow established agile practices. Proactively asking questions and documenting processes can also help ensure smooth collaboration and project success.

What are Software Engineers?

Software Engineers are professionals who design, develop, test, and maintain software applications or systems. They apply engineering principles and systematic methods to create reliable and efficient software solutions that meet user needs. Software Engineers may work on a variety of projects, from mobile apps and web platforms to embedded systems and enterprise software. They often collaborate with other engineers, designers, and stakeholders throughout the software development lifecycle.

At Relativity, engineers don't just write code. They help build distributed systems that process massive volumes of complex data, enabling users to uncover meaningful insights and act with confidence in high-stakes environments.

The Enrichment team powers the ingestion and transformation of terabytes of complex and abstract data into Relativity's Review platform. The team focuses on solving large-scale data challenges, including high-throughput ingestion, data extraction, and transformation across diverse document sets. Engineers on this team build highly distributed systems composed of multiple data stores, processing layers, and web services, while also modernizing the user experience and improving performance at scale. If you're excited about working with big data, solving complex scalability challenges, and building systems on a secure SaaS platform, this is a team where you can have real impact.

About The Role

As a Software Engineer, you will contribute to building Relativity's cloud-based platform by designing and operating highly scalable, distributed systems. You will work on dynamic web applications and serverless technologies, helping to process and transform large volumes of data efficiently and reliably. This role reports to the Manager of Software Engineering and offers the opportunity to work across multiple layers of the system, gaining experience in distributed architecture, cloud technologies, and large-scale data processing.
